显然,我正在使用telnetlib.expect()与一个以字节串响应的设备进行接口。除非我在传递给expect()的正则表达式(预编译或文字)中使用字节字符串,否则将生成一个异常:TypeError: cannot use a string pattern on a bytes-like object。然而,pycodestyle抱怨这是W605 invalid escape sequence '\d',进一步的阅读使我认为这将成为将来的Python语法错误。
总结如下:
telnetlib.expect([b'\d']) # OK, but W065
tel
我有3个页面,加载相同的幻灯片。我试图通过将变量中的新内容从javascript传递到html元素来合并到一个页面。效果应该类似于ajax。传递的内容包括html标记。一切正常,但是如果我在文本中包含一个撇号符号,它就会失败。我可以通过使用锐化符号来解决这个问题;但是我想使用撇号。下面是标记和脚本的示例。在火狐、chrome和ie9上也是如此。没什么大不了的,但我想知道它为什么会失败。有什么想法吗?
<?php
// Test of script passing content to <p> element
?>
<!DOCTYPE html PUBLIC
我正在尝试使用正则表达式来处理多行文本字符串。我需要这个来为python工作。
示例文本:
description : "4.10 TCP Wrappers - not installed"
info : "If some of the services running in /etc/inetd.conf are
required, then it is recommended that TCP Wrappers are installed and configured to limit access to any active TCP and UD
这是我尝试过的最艰难的事情之一。多年来,我一直在搜索,但是我无法找到这样的方法--匹配一个不被给定字符包围的字符串,比如引号或大于/小于符号。
像这样的正则表达式可以匹配不存在于HTML链接中的URL、不以引号表示的SQL table.column值以及许多其他内容。
Example with quotes:
Match [THIS] and "something with [NOT THIS] followed by" or even [THIS].
Example with <,>, & "
Match [URL] and <a hr
我有一个Python程序,它从从Internet复制的文件中读取文本,并将其存储在一个变量中以供进一步使用。它非常简单,是这样的:
Line=(Storefile.readline())
Word=Line[:-1]
(:-1去掉回车符('\n'))
如果我在IDLE中写单词,它会返回-‘面包’
一切工作正常,直到读取行中有一个撇号。在这种情况下,在IDLE中写单词会给出“面包”。“面包”与“面包”-单引号与双引号
如果我在逐个字符的基础上组成单词变量:
for n in range(len(Word)):
Word=Word+Word[n]
Wordn是撇号的那一刻--单引号
我的印象是,在Python中,用r'this is a raw string'编写的原始字符串将省略任何转义字符,并准确地在引号之间打印。我的问题是,当我尝试print r'\'时,我得到了SyntaxError: EOL while scanning string literal。不过,print r'\n'正确地打印了\n。
我必须创建一个自定义文本域,这是也支持一些数学表达式。所以我想到了使用JQMath。
我必须使用javascript传递一个带有html输入字段的表达式。它将被动态添加。所以我把表达式放在一个随时都可以改变的字符串中。但是如果我使用字符串,它不会给出正的输出。我用谷歌搜索了很多关于这方面的信息,但我就是找不到。请在这方面帮帮我。
下面是我的代码。
var string = "$x={-b±√{b^2-4ac}}/{2a\html'<input size=1 >'}$"
var di = document.createElement("
我想把它打印出来
this is '(single quote) and "(double quote)
我使用以下代码(我想在这里使用原始字符串'r‘)
a=r'this is \'(single quote) and "(double quote)'
但它会打印出来
this is \'(single quote) and "(double quote)
在原始字符串中转义‘的正确方法是什么?
在Java中,我有一个字符串形式的任意HTML文档。为了简单起见,可以这样说:
String original = "Hello, <strong>this</strong> is a string";
我有字符串中不同位置的记录,总是在文本中,而不是在标记中。例如,单词"is“的开头和结尾的索引是29和31。
然后,我对字符串执行转换-在本例中,去掉了HTML标记。剩下的就是:
original = "Hello, this is a string";
现在有没有一种优雅的方法来获得单词" Is“的新的开始和结束索引(1